1.物理備份
物理備份指的是將數(shù)據(jù)庫的物理文件進(jìn)行備份,包括數(shù)據(jù)文件、日志文件等。物理備份通常比較快速,也比較容易實(shí)現(xiàn),但是備份文件比較大,不便于傳輸和存儲。
2.邏輯備份
邏輯備份指的是將數(shù)據(jù)庫中的數(shù)據(jù)以SQL語句的形式進(jìn)行備份。邏輯備份比較靈活,備份文件比較小,便于傳輸和存儲,但是備份和恢復(fù)的速度比較慢。
1.確定備份方式
在備份之前,需要確定備份方式。根據(jù)實(shí)際情況選擇物理備份或邏輯備份。
2.選擇備份工具
ysqldumpysqlhotcopyysqlbackup等。根據(jù)備份需求選擇合適的備份工具。
3.備份數(shù)據(jù)
使用備份工具備份MySQL數(shù)據(jù)。備份過程中需要注意備份文件的存儲位置、備份文件名、備份方式等參數(shù)。
4.驗(yàn)證備份文件
d5sum命令進(jìn)行驗(yàn)證。
1.備份頻率
備份頻率應(yīng)該根據(jù)數(shù)據(jù)的重要性和變化頻率來確定。一般來說,數(shù)據(jù)量大、變化頻率高的數(shù)據(jù)庫需要更頻繁地備份。
2.備份存儲位置
備份文件的存儲位置需要考慮數(shù)據(jù)的安全性和可靠性。最好將備份文件存儲在不同的位置,避免單點(diǎn)故障。
3.備份文件命名
備份文件命名應(yīng)該具有唯一性和可讀性。可以使用日期、時間、備份方式等信息作為備份文件名的一部分。
4.備份文件的傳輸和存儲
備份文件的傳輸和存儲需要保證數(shù)據(jù)的安全性和完整性。可以使用加密、壓縮等方式進(jìn)行傳輸和存儲。
MySQL數(shù)據(jù)備份是保障數(shù)據(jù)安全和可靠性的重要環(huán)節(jié)。在備份過程中需要選擇合適的備份方式和備份工具,注意備份頻率、存儲位置、文件命名、傳輸和存儲等方面的問題,確保備份文件的安全和可靠。